PROBLEM: The Writing Spiral

Generally, students are poor writers and don’t get the instruction in school they need to improve their writing skills. Many teachers are not great writers themselves because writing instruction, even at the college level, is generally poor.(1) Further, students don’t like to write because writing in school is tedious, especially when many learn to write using social media, which encourages quick, short snippets of unstructured communication. Unengaged students and ill-equipped teachers combine to create a classroom that dreads writing instruction. This inertia inevitably means less attention is given to writing instruction and then, to even more frustration. And so on…This downward cycle begins in elementary school and just continues, leaving many students ill equipped for college and careers where they are expected to already be good writers. Students leave K-12 ill equipped to write effectively and unprepared to navigate a world full of misinterpretation and ambiguity that actually places great value on good writing (e.g., applying to college or for a job). At Pressto, we call this The Writing Spiral.
